
Steve Kundert, CBRE -Debt Expert, $12+ Billion Financed
01/10/24 • 89 min
It’s with great pleasure that I welcome today’s guest, Steve Kundert, Senior Vice President of CBRE’s Debt and Structured Finance Group. Steve joins us to share his vast knowledge and expertise on capitalizing real estate projects. With over 20 years of experience in the mortgage industry, Steve has an unparalleled understanding of the intricacies of multifamily properties.

Car Wash and Mobile Home Park Investing | Matt Fore of Next Level Income
In this episode of Breneman Blueprint, let’s dive into personal finance as my incredible guest Matt Fore shares his journey from technology sales to a thriving real estate career.
Matt is an investor who focuses on niche asset classes like car washes, mobile home parks, and real estate debt. Currently, through his company Next Level Income, he operates over 30 car wash locations and several mobile home parks. Their goal is to acquire 100 car wash locations by 2025.
Join us as Matt uncovers his unique approach to achieving financial independence in just 3 years, utilizing clever strategies like recycling capital and investing in niche assets such as mobile home parks and real estate debt.
